Description
Business owners in Downtown Kirkland say they are nervous and concerned about an upcoming construction project, which will fully closure a main intersection to cars for at least two months.
Starting April 1, an eight-week closure of the intersection of Lake Street and Kirkland Avenue is scheduled so that the city can do construction on the Lake Street Scramble project.
The eight-week closure was originally scheduled for last July and August, but the city pushed the project to this spring after businesses shared concerns over the project taking place during the busiest months of summer.
Although some businesses said they appreciate the city moving the date, they said the closure will still greatly impact all the businesses near the intersection. Some businesses fear it will be detrimental.
